Outokumpu’s Circle Green Stainless Steel Powers Grundfos’ Sustainability Goals

Outokumpu has agreed to supply Denmark-based water pump maker Grundfos with its Circle Green stainless steel. This year, about 90% of stainless steel used by Grundfos globally comes from Outokumpu’s eco-friendly product. The Circle Green brand achieves up to a 93% lower carbon footprint compared to industry averages. To do this, Outokumpu heavily relies on recycled feedstock, with scrap content between 90% and 98%.

Jörg Müller, sales executive at Outokumpu, said stainless steel remains essential for clean energy and water solutions. He emphasized that Circle Green supports innovation while reducing environmental impact. Notably, the stainless steel from Circle Green perfectly aligns with Grundfos’ sustainability goals, which fits Outokumpu’s mission to decarbonize supply chains.

 

Grundfos Expands U.S. Operations with Sustainable Materials Focus

Grundfos, operating globally with a strong presence in the U.S., is expanding its Texas facility. This investment aims to boost production capacity for water utilities and commercial buildings. Additionally, Grundfos plans to meet rising demand for data center cooling solutions, leveraging sustainable stainless steel materials.

Ulrik Gernow, Grundfos COO, highlighted the company’s partnership with Outokumpu as a key step in their supply chain decarbonization. Switching to green steel reduces Grundfos’ carbon footprint and helps customers cut theirs, emphasizing the role of the specific Circle Green stainless material. Bent Jensen, CEO of Grundfos Commercial Building Services, emphasized the importance of sustainable building innovations and growing demand for energy-efficient cooling.
